Mary Young was installed as the new mayor of Arcadia, while Charles Gilb was named mayor pro-tem. Donald Pellegrino and David Hannah stepped down from the council to be replaced by Roger Chandler and Robert Harbicht.
By unanimous vote of the City Council, Donald Pellegrino was selected as mayor of Arcadia for the 1985-86 year and Mary Young was selected to replace him as mayor pro-tem.
Marilyn Morrison, community relations director for Methodist Hospital, and John Joseph, chairman of the Senior Citizens Commission have been named Arcadia Citizens of the Year by the Chamber of Commerce.
Four candidates are running for this year's City Council election: Mayor Charles Gilb, Councilwoman Mary Young, Charles Chivetta and Johanna A. M. Hofer.
Lee Lurie has been selected Arcadia Senior Citizen of the year. Lurie has been very active this past year in senior citizen projects and in the scouting program. Biographical notes are included.
Catherine Mundy and Lyle Cunningham received Citizen of the Year awards at the 67th annual dinner dance of the Arcadia Chamber of Commerce. Article gives sketches of their community services.
Genevieve Bloom has been named Senior Citizen of the Year. Mrs. Bloom has been visiting local convalescent homes and hospitals for the past 37 years singing to the patients. Biographical notes included.
For the first time in the history of the Arcadia Chamber of Commerce, 2 women will receive the Citizen of the Year Award. Mrs. Dottie Burnett and Mrs. June Fee were chosen for the honor from among 10 nominees.
